ا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

محمد طاهر عرفه

إدارة الموقع
  • Posts

    8730
  • تاريخ الانضمام

  • تاريخ اخر زياره

  • Days Won

    37

كل منشورات العضو محمد طاهر عرفه

  1. هناك طريقة أخري من الوورد احفظ الصفحة ك صفحة ويب File save as web page ثم من الاكسيل data import external data و نختار all files ثم نحدد مكان الملف و نختاره ثم Import
  2. هل تواجهك نفس المشكلة اذا نفذت امر المسح من القائمة Edit clear contents اذا لا ، فالاغلب ان المشكلة فى لوحة المفاتيح
  3. السلام عليكم أولا أشكر الأخوة على و خالد علي و أخص بالشكر الأخ mn20 على اضافته و بالنسبة للسؤال : أين أنت ياأستاذ محمد طاهر ؟ الإجابة : حالياً ، فى المنزل و بالتحديد أمام الكمبيوتر طبعا هذا ليس مقصد السؤال ! الحقيقة أني منذ فترة ليست بقصيرة لا أستطيع متابعة المشاركات بانتظام و على قدر ما يؤلمني ذلك ، على قدر ما أشعر باسعادة و الفخر لاستمرار عطاء الموقع اعتماداً علي أخوة أفاضل عوضوا غياب العديد من أعمدة الموقع الذين غابوا تباعاً بكفاءة و إخلاص ، بل و أضافوا كثيرا بأسلوب مختلف ، و هذا مدعاة فخر و سعادة لنا جميعا و أتمني أن يزيد ذلك و أن يتضاعف عدد الفاعلين من الأخوة فى الموقع و أن يصل الحال الي الوضع الامثل و هو أن يكون أغلب الأخوة متفاعلين فى الاضافة و الرد و أخيرا لا أستطيع ترك الموضع دون أن ألفت نظرالأخوة بحكم العادة الي عدم تخصيص شخص معين بطلب اجابة معينة ، لان هذا يتنافي مع قواعد المشاركة ، و لأن ذلك قد يغلق باب اجابة أفضل تأتي من شخص أعلم بالموضوع و نهاية أعتذر للجميع عن عدم التواجد و أشكر كل من يساهم فى استمرارعطاء الموقع ، و أدعو الله سبحانه و تعالي أن يجعله من باب علم ينتفع به ، ينفع حيث لا ينفع الندم و أن يزيد من عددهم و أن يجعلنا منهم و أن يستعملنا و لا يستبدلنا وييسر لنا سلوك دروب الخير و العلم و قضاء حوائج الآخرين.
  4. اذا فتحت أي زر من أزرار طباعة التقارير مثلا ستجد الكود الخاص بالطباعة بهذه الصيغة Dim stDocName As String stDocName = "reportname" DoCmd.OpenReport stDocName, acPreview او مباشرة: DoCmd.OpenReport "reportname" و ما قصده الأخ رضوان هو تكرار الكود داخل نفس الأمر DoCmd.OpenReport "report1" DoCmd.OpenReport "report2" DoCmd.OpenReport "report3"
  5. راجع الدرس رقم 12 فى هذا الموضوع http://www.officena.net/ib/index.php?showtopic=228 اذا كان الجدولان بنفس الاسم فيمكنك استخدام التصدير مع اختيار الاستبدال و هذا مثال من التعليمات علي تنفيذ حذف الجدول بالكود This example deletes the Employees table from the database. Sub DropX2() Dim dbs As Database ' Modify this line to include the path to Northwind ' on your computer. Set dbs = OpenDatabase("Northwind.mdb") ' Delete the Employees table. dbs.Execute "DROP TABLE Employees;" dbs.Close End Sub و هذخ أمثلة أيضا من التعليمات علي انشاء جدول This example creates a new table called ThisTable with two text fields. Sub CreateTableX1() Dim dbs As Database ' Modify this line to include the path to Northwind ' on your computer. Set dbs = OpenDatabase("Northwind.mdb") ' Create a table with two text fields. dbs.Execute "CREATE TABLE ThisTable " _ & "(FirstName CHAR, LastName CHAR);" dbs.Close End Sub This example creates a new table called MyTable with two text fields, a Date/Time field, and a unique index made up of all three fields. Sub CreateTableX2() Dim dbs As Database ' Modify this line to include the path to Northwind ' on your computer. Set dbs = OpenDatabase("Northwind.mdb") ' Create a table with three fields and a unique ' index made up of all three fields. dbs.Execute "CREATE TABLE MyTable " _ & "(FirstName CHAR, LastName CHAR, " _ & "DateOfBirth DATETIME, " _ & "CONSTRAINT MyTableConstraint UNIQUE " _ & "(FirstName, LastName, DateOfBirth));" dbs.Close End Sub This example creates a new table with two text fields and an Integer field. The SSN field is the primary key. Sub CreateTableX3() Dim dbs As Database ' Modify this line to include the path to Northwind ' on your computer. Set dbs = OpenDatabase("Northwind.mdb") ' Create a table with three fields and a primary ' key. dbs.Execute "CREATE TABLE NewTable " _ & "(FirstName CHAR, LastName CHAR, " _ & "SSN INTEGER CONSTRAINT MyFieldConstraint " _ & "PRIMARY KEY);" dbs.Close End Sub
  6. تم التعديل الرسائل الخاصة ليست مفعلة للأعضاء ، و انما لباقي المجموعات فقط ( المميزين ، و المحترفين ، و المشرفين ، و الرواد ) و باذن الله بعد الانضمام الي اي من هذه المجموعات ستكون الرسائل مفعلة بحسب قواعد المنتدي
  7. السلام عليكم بالنسبة لي أيضا لم يتخط الماكرو مستوي الامان مرتفع جدا و ربما السبب فى تخطيه لديك اخي تامر هو خيار الوثوق بال vba Tools Macro Security و اختار علامة التبويب الثانية trusted publishers و راجع الخيارات أسفل الصفحة فاذا كان الخيار الثاني مفعلا فهذا سييسمح بتشغيل الماكرو و هذه الشاشة تتيح لنا التحكم فى ما تم تعريفه بالمصدر الموثوق به اذ يمكنك تعريف المصدار الموثوقة و حذفها و اعتقد هذا يحل المشكلة الي حد كبير و اذا كان لديك ماكروهات لها توقيع اليكتروني digital signature فيمكنك التجربة ، فكما ذكرت فى الموضع السابق اني لم يسبق لي التجربة و لكن علي الاقل نظريا اعتقد ان الموضوع محلول باستخدام هذه الخيارات ، او اتمني ان يكون كذلك
  8. قد يكون الجواب غير مناسب و لكن كثيرا ما يحدث هذا فقط بسبب السهو و أن اللغة العربية/انجليزية أو بسبب ال caps lock عموما اطلب من مسئول الشبكة ان ياتي و يتاكد من الدخول لمرة ثم اختار خيار الاحتفاظ بكلمة السر بحيث لا يسألك بعدها
  9. لا لم نفقد شيئا بفضل من الله ، ثم بجهد أخونا محمد قطان اللهم الا اذا كانت هناك مشاركات أضيفت عند لحظة التوقف تحديداً
  10. تم اختراق المنتدي منذ يوين و نعتذر عن الرسائل الدعائية التي تم ارسالها للأعضاء كدعاية لموقعين و الله أعلم ان كان المخترق له علاقة بهذه المنتديات ام لا و لكن الهدف كان الدعاية لها سواء عن طريق البريد الذي تم ارسالها او نوافذ دعائية تظهر كلما تصفحت المنتدي و بفضل من الله ، ثم بجهد أخونا محمد قطان تم استعادة كامل البيانات نعتذر عن التوقف و أهلا بكم مرة أخري
  11. السلام عليكم اعتقد ان السبب هو البروكسي الذي تتصل منه
  12. ايضا احد الاخطاء الدارجة ، هو حفظ الملفات بامتداد dot و ليس doc فلا تظهر عند محاولة فتح الملف من قائمة File open باعداداته الافتراضية و للتأكد من ذلك عند اختيار file open او ملف - فتح اختار بدلا من ملفات الوورد فى مربع الحوار الاسفل All files
  13. السلام عليكم جزاك الله خيرا جاري الان الترقية للنسخة الاخيرة من المنتدي و هي اخر الاصدرات التي اصدرتها الشركة و بالنسبة للخط اعتقد انه الان مناسب و اذا لديكم ملاحظات اخري نرجو اضافتها فى هذا الموضوع بالنسبة للنسخة ستجدوا فيها اضافات كثيرة اهمها ان مشكلة حفظ الصفحات قد انتهت و الان يمكن حفظ اي مواضيع فى صورة ملف وورد و ذلك باختيار تنزيل الموضوع من قائمة خيارات
  14. الي حد ما التنسيق لن يتغير اذا كانت البيانات حجمها ثابث من الوان و اطارات و خلافه اما عن عرض الخلايا فأعتقد أنه سيتغير مع كل تحديث للبيانات
  15. سبب ظهور العلامة هو أن الخلايا التي تحسب المعادلة بناء عليها ليست خالية و لكن بها معلومة و هي علامة المسافة الفاضية space جري تحرير الخلية و اخلاؤها ستجد العلامة اختفت
  16. السلام عليكم أخي الكريم صراحة بالنسبة لي كانت التصفية العادية تؤدي ما احتاج بنجاح عن طريق عمل تصفية علي اكثر من عمود فى نفس الوقت و اراه حل عملي جدا و ايضا التصفية في الجداول المحورية تناسب العديد من الاحتياجات ( عمل جدول محوري pivot table) ثم عمل تصفية داخله بالاختيار من القائمة المنسدلة و ايضا هناك التصفية المتقدمة التي تجري مناقشتها الان فى موضوع مستقل رجاء توضيح ما الذي تريد عمله بالكود و لا يمكن عمله بالامكانيات الجاهزة للاكسيل
  17. تأكد من أن الماكرو لديك مفعل Tools Macro security level Medium أو Low جربت الملف و يعمل معي و المفترض ان يعمل علي النسخة العربية ايضا انزل الملف المرفق و تنقل بين ورقتي العمل و اخبرنا ماذا يحدث فان لم يعمل بعد التأكد من تفعيل الماكرو فقم يتسجيل ماكرو جديد عن طريق التسجيل و قم بحذف ال Toolbars ثم اوقف التسجيل ثم اختار تحرير الماكرو و انظر كيف تم تسجيل أسماء الادوات و اخيرنا
  18. مرفق المثال بعد التعديل و ملاحظ اختلاف النتائج Pivot2.rar
  19. السلام عليكم تم تعديل سياية المنتدي بالنسبة لتحميل المرفقات للاعضاء تم اضافة صلاحية تحميل الملفات فى الأقسام العامة لجميع الأعضاء بخلاف السياسية السابقة بكون التحميل للاعضاء المميزين فقط و بالنسبة لقسم التحميل المؤقت نرجو ممن لديه ملف مفيد تم تحميله في هذا القسم اعادة تحميله فى المشاركة الاصلية فى القسم العام و سنقوم كفريق للموقع باذن الله بالعمل علي نقل الملفات المفيدة منه الي الاقسام المناظرة
  20. يبدو ان ذلك صعب التحقيق فحتي لو حاولنا التعامل مع المحاذة من منطلق عد الحروف فالعرض الذي يشغله كل حرف مختلف عن الاخر اذا كان هناك سبيل الي ذلك بالكود فعلينا ان نجد طريقة لمعرفة العرض الذي يشغله كل حرف فى الخلية و هذا الأخير يختلف باختلاف الحرف و ايضا باختلاف الفونت لذا اري ما تريده يبدو لي صعب التحقيق الا اذا وردت فكرة أخري للتفكير فى كيفية معالجة الموضوع
  21. راجع الموضوع المثبت في قسم تحليل البيانات بالارشيف http://www.officena.net/ib/index.php?showforum=49
  22. هذا النوع من التحليل اول ما افكر فيه عندما يقابلني هو الجداول المحورية pivot tables
  23. لابد من عمل ذلك بالكود و الله أعلم فى حدث التفعيل للشيت Private Sub Worksheet_Activate() Application.CommandBars("Forms").Visible = True Application.CommandBars("Standard").Visible = True Application.CommandBars("Formatting").Visible = True End Sub و طبعا الايقونات اعلاه كمثال فقط و يمكنك تحديد الايقونات التي تريدها و العكس بالنسبة للشيت الاخر IconPerSheet.zip
  24. لنفترض أنك تريد تطبيق الفلتر علي العمود االاول بناء علي القيمة الموجودة فى الخلية a1 اكتب القيمة فى الخلية a1 ثم شغل الماكرو الكود فى الملف المرفق Selection.AutoFilter Field:=1, Criteria1:=Range("a1") Range("a1").Select filterauto.zip
  25. مرفق مثال اختر احدي الخلايا ثم اختار قائمة التنسيق الشرطي من قائمة تنسيق لتري كيفية كتابة الشرط Format Conditional format الشرط معد بحيث ان اللون اذا كانت القيمة 7 او اكثر تلون بالازرق و ان كان اقل من 6 تلون بالاحمر و للتنفيذ اختار الخلايا المراد تلوينها و نفذ نفس التنسيق او اختار نسخ و لصق التنسيق من الخلايا فى الملف الي ملفك conditional.zip
×
×
  • اضف...

Important Information